Output 9620dc6ac28ea633a51e8a1d4dbe4f52f08bc9e785d93ea73c3548f163c188f8:1

value
18349664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e5f10835f9578554aff7567e26f0b9661ff22d OP_EQUAL
address
3PemZCbbJT4LPNQ3MQHYtgDZ25QUjJnZWz
transaction
9620dc6ac28ea633a51e8a1d4dbe4f52f08bc9e785d93ea73c3548f163c188f8
confirmations
211135
spent
true